summary refs log tree commit diff stats
diff options
context:
space:
mode:
authorLucas F. Souza <me@lucasfsouza.com.br>2019-06-05 23:20:27 +0200
committerDrew DeVault <sir@cmpwn.com>2019-06-07 09:20:06 -0400
commit2279ac3ab3d19cd233600907bc8e3e8b4e57b350 (patch)
tree041ed5fb64fcf4c48fd02985079342b50bac6732
parent92dc31bad0dc69fa96b04242b635fee051ed1965 (diff)
downloadaerc-2279ac3ab3d19cd233600907bc8e3e8b4e57b350.tar.gz
Skip rendering dirlist if sidebar width is 0
-rw-r--r--widgets/account.go4
1 files changed, 3 insertions, 1 deletions
diff --git a/widgets/account.go b/widgets/account.go
index 4526c02..0feac4a 100644
--- a/widgets/account.go
+++ b/widgets/account.go
@@ -48,7 +48,9 @@ func NewAccountView(conf *config.AercConfig, acct *config.AccountConfig,
 	}
 
 	dirlist := NewDirectoryList(acct, logger, worker)
-	grid.AddChild(ui.NewBordered(dirlist, ui.BORDER_RIGHT))
+	if (conf.Ui.SidebarWidth > 0) {
+		grid.AddChild(ui.NewBordered(dirlist, ui.BORDER_RIGHT))
+	}
 
 	msglist := NewMessageList(conf, logger)
 	grid.AddChild(msglist).At(0, 1)